Transaction 44004fa4dbe24f5f646d56740d3873c7826eb0ef699057f6aaaf60c1144074e6

3 Input
1 Outputs
  • 44004fa4dbe24f5f646d56740d3873c7826eb0ef699057f6aaaf60c1144074e6:0
  • value  641170
    address  3MBeg23fyT1CV7qzVk7DvfWJQZD7QbxD1o